Who Owns Infrea Today?

Infrea AB is owned by its shareholders, not by a parent company or a single industrial sponsor. The largest disclosed owners matter most because they shape voting power, board choices, and capital allocation, which is how the market reads Infrea ownership and Infrea brand trust.

What Does Infrea's Ownership Mean for Brand Credibility?

Infrea AB's ownership supports brand trust when it looks stable, transparent, and tied to long-term infrastructure work. In that case, Infrea ownership helps the market believe the brand can keep steady cash flow discipline and avoid short-term noise.

Icon Stable ownership strengthens long-term credibility

For Who owns Infrea and Infrea company ownership, the strongest signal is consistency. When the Infrea shareholders, Infrea board of directors, and management stay aligned with the infrastructure model, the brand looks dependable, not promotional.

That matters because Infrea AB works across renewable energy, water & sewerage, district heating, and recycling. A stable Infrea ownership structure supports the idea that capital is being used for durable assets and predictable returns, not for quick image gains.
